The coronavirus pandemic and online learning have shown that all schools should become 1-to-1 — not just with computers, but also for cementing student-teacher relationships, one advocate says. “Those staff-student connections should become the norm,” says Jonah Edelman, founder & CEO of Stand for Children, a nonprofit focused on equity in education. “It absolutely needs to become the norm during the pandemic to prevent a huge number of students from dropping off the map.” READ MORE
